i just had to have my 9.25 with lsd and 3.92's rebuilt...a common problem with them so hopefully you don't find any metal in your diff. I was/had them put in Mobil 1 full synthetic 75w-90 in the rear with the limited slip modifier. It takes a little over 2 quarts so you'll need 3 bottles of it. here is a good diy i found for the rear https://dodgeforum.com/m_569784/tm.htm
